Low Carb Subway Style Chocolate Chip Cookies

Indulge your sweet tooth guilt-free with these irresistible Low Carb Subway-Style Chocolate Chip Cookies! Crafted to deliver the soft, chewy texture and rich flavor of classic cookies, this recipe features wholesome ingredients like almond flour, coconut flour, and sugar-free chocolate chips for a keto-friendly twist. Sweetened with erythritol or monk fruit, these cookies are low-carb, gluten-free, and perfect for anyone following a keto or diabetic-friendly diet. With just 15 minutes of prep time and a quick bake in the oven, you’ll have a batch of golden, perfectly soft cookies that taste just like your favorite bakery-style treat. Enjoy them warm or at room temperature as a satisfying snack or dessert!

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:12 mins
Total Time:27 mins
Servings: 10

Ingredients

  • 1.5 cups Almond flour
  • 2 tablespoons Coconut flour
  • 0.5 cups Unsalted butter (softened)
  • 0.75 cups Erythritol or monk fruit sweetener
  • 1 Egg
  • 1 teaspoons Pure vanilla extract
  • 0.75 cups Sugar-free chocolate chips
  • 0.5 teaspoons Baking powder
  • 0.25 teaspoons Salt

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

Step 2

In a medium mixing bowl, combine almond flour, coconut fl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.

Step 3

In a separate large bowl, use an electric hand mixer to cream the softened butter and erythritol (or monk fruit sweetener) until light and fluffy.

Step 4

Add the egg and vanilla extract to the butter mixture. Beat until well combined.

Step 5

Gradually mix the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ients, using the hand mixer on low speed, until a cohesive dough forms.

Step 6

Fold in the sugar-free chocolate chips using a rubber spatula or spoon.

Step 7

Scoop out dough using a cookie scoop or tablespoon and roll into golf-ball-sized balls. Flatten slightly and place on the prepared baking sheet, leaving about 1.5 inches of space between the cookies.

Step 8

Bake in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den. The cookies will be soft in the center but will firm up as they cool.

Step 9

Remove the baking sheet from the oven and allow the cookies to cool on it for 10 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Step 10

Enjoy your homemade low-carb Subway-style chocolate chip cookies as a delicious treat!
